For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 464 students in BASIS Charter Schools Inc. (783027). This district's average testing ranking is 10/10, which is in the top 5% of public schools in Arizona.
Public School in BASIS Charter School Inc. (783027) have an average math proficiency score of 82% (versus the Arizona public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 82% (versus the 41%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 81% of the student body (majority Asian), which is more than the Arizona public school average of 67%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$8,254 in this school district is less than the state median of $11,558.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$8,274 is less than the state median of $11,459.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
